Objective and Utility of the Department

The wing is entrusted with the work of checking and inspection of weights and measures in all the commercial establishments across Chandigarh. The main objectives of the Legal Metrology Wing is to safe guard the interest of the consumers by ensuring that goods sold and bought are correct in quantity and volume as claimed


Organisation of the Department

The wing is responsible for maintaining uniformity and accuracy in all weights and measures, weighing and measuring Instruments used by traders The main functions of the Department is to implement the provisions of the Legal Metrology Act, 2009, the Legal Metrology (General) Rules, 2011, the Legal Metrology (Enforcement) Rules, 2011 and the Legal Metrology (Packaged Commodities) Rules, 2011 .Weights & Measures Laws are basic consumer protection legislation which affects every section of the Society The public should get the right quantity for which they pay for and the enforcement officers should repose confidence not only among the consumers but also with the traders and manufacturers by ensuring fair trade practices.
